site stats

Rdd is a programming paradigm

WebMar 12, 2024 · Here, we’ll be comparing three specific paradigms: imperative, functional, and object-oriented. If you’ve done programming in Python or C, you’ve used imperative programming. Imperative programming defines the solution to a problem as a series of steps—first do this, then do that, then do the next thing, and so on. WebJan 6, 2024 · It enables the development of distributed and parallel applications using many programming languages, relieving developers from having to deal with classical …

What Is A Programming Paradigm?. An overview of programming paradigms …

WebRDDs are created by starting with a file in the Hadoop file system (or any other Hadoop-supported file system), or an existing Scala collection in the driver program, and … WebJul 26, 2024 · Languages that support Logic Programming: Prolog; Absys; ALF (algebraic logic functional programming language) Alice; Ciao; Functional Programming Functional Programming is by far the most used declarative programming paradigm, the basic premise is that programs are constructed by applying and composing functions. Let's take a look … chubby pug dog https://theresalesolution.com

RDD Software Development Abbreviation Meaning - All Acronyms

WebMar 30, 2024 · 3. Functional Programming. The key concepts of this paradigm are expressions, functions, parametric polymorphism, and data abstraction. Expressions are the fundamental components of the functions used by functional programming languages. Parametric polymorphism is one of three types of polymorphism. http://jyp.github.io/pp/Lectures.html WebNone of the options RDD is a programming paradigm RDD is a distributed data structure RDD is a database RDD is ____________ Recomputable Fault-tolerant All the options Immutable We can edit the data of RDD like conversion to uppercase. True False Choose the correct statement. chubby pug song

Spark Training- Post Test - ProProfs Quiz

Category:Responsibility-driven design - Wikipedia

Tags:Rdd is a programming paradigm

Rdd is a programming paradigm

RDD Programming Guide - Spark 3.3.2 Documentation

WebDec 22, 2015 · RDD (Resilient Distributed Datasets) are an abstraction for representing data. Formally they are a read-only, partitioned collection of records that provides a … WebNov 12, 2024 · PySpark RDD: Everything You Need to Know About PySpark RDD Lesson - 29. Wipro Interview Questions and Answers That You Should Know Before Going for an Interview Lesson - 30. How to Use Typescript With Nodejs: The Ultimate Guide ... C# is a general-purpose, multi-paradigm programming language. C# encompasses static typing, …

Rdd is a programming paradigm

Did you know?

WebOct 16, 2024 · A programming paradigm is the concept by which the methodology of a programming language adheres to. Paradigms are important because they define a programming language and how it works. A great way to think about a paradigm is as a set of ideas that a programming language can use to perform tasks in terms of machine … WebJan 20, 2024 · 2. Spark RDD. RDDs are an immutable, resilient, and distributed representation of a collection of records partitioned across all nodes in the cluster. In Spark programming, RDDs are the primordial data structure. …

WebApr 10, 2024 · That is what happens in Imperative Programming Paradigm. Programs implemented using this Paradigm tells the computer how it should complete a task by defining each step clearly. WebJul 28, 2024 · DataFrame (DF) –. DataFrame is an abstraction which gives a schema view of data. Which means it gives us a view of data as columns with column name and types info, We can think data in data frame like a table in the database. Like RDD, execution in Dataframe too is lazy triggered. let’s see an example for creating DataFrame –.

WebRDD may refer to: . Adygeya Airlines, by ICAO airline designator; Radar detector detector; Radiological dispersion device, a weapon designed to spread radioactive material; Rally … Web•RDD can be modeled using the Bulk Synchronous Parallel (BSP) model RDD Processing Model Independent Local Processing Independent Local Processing Independent Local …

WebSpark is the first fast, general purpose distributed computing paradigm resulting from this shift and is gaining popularity rapidly. Spark extends the MapReduce model to support more types of computations using a functional programming paradigm, and it can cover a wide range of workflows that previously were implemented as specialized systems ...

designer crop top high waisted shorts comboWebJava. Python. Spark 2.2.0 is built and distributed to work with Scala 2.11 by default. (Spark can be built to work with other versions of Scala, too.) To write applications in Scala, you will need to use a compatible Scala version (e.g. 2.11.X). To write a Spark application, you need to add a Maven dependency on Spark. chubby puppies and friends toysWebAs Spark is written in a functional programming paradigm, one of the key concepts of functional programming is immutable objects. Resilient Distributed Dataset is also an … chubby puppies official websiteWebMar 3, 2016 · Eventually, all programming may revolve around a number of patterns; the old ways are abandoned. This is the paradigm shift: a new way of thinking appears. Eventually, a new programming language may be developed to support the "patterns" directly. chubby puppies commercialWebMapReduce is a programming paradigm that enables massive scalability across hundreds or thousands of servers in a Hadoop cluster. As the processing component, MapReduce is the heart of Apache Hadoop. The term "MapReduce" refers to two separate and distinct tasks that Hadoop programs perform. The first is the map job, which takes a set of data ... designer crop top for lehengaWebSource: Exxact. Spark is implemented on Hadoop/HDFS and written mostly in Scala, a functional programming language, similar to Java.In fact, Scala needs the latest Java installation on your system and runs on JVM. However, for most beginners, Scala is not a language that they learn first to venture into the world of data science. chubby puppies and friends pet fun centerWebfine RDDs (x2.1) and introduce their programming inter-face in Spark (x2.2). We then compare RDDs with finer-grained shared memory abstractions (x2.3). Finally, we discuss limitations of the RDD model (x2.4). 2.1 RDD Abstraction Formally, an RDD is a read-only, partitioned collection of records. RDDs can only be created through determin- designer crochet triangle shawl patterns